The book is structured into thematic weeks, each with a catchy, memorable title to motivate learners. For example, the first week is titled "I can't help remembering," and the sixth week is "As long as you do it, let's remember". This clever approach helps contextualize the grammar points and makes the learning process more engaging and less intimidating.

Yes, absolutely! With multilingual explanations and a clear daily schedule, it's designed for independent learners. However, some learners find the grammar explanations somewhat brief compared to other resources like Shin Kanzen Master. If you need more detailed explanations, supplement it with a grammar dictionary or online resources.

The JLPT N2 exam frequently tests your knowledge of how words connect. For instance, knowing whether a grammar structure requires a Na-adjective to keep its na , change to de , or add dearu is critical. Create a dedicated cheat sheet tracking these specific rules. 2.
